How to obtain a Birth Certificate

You can get a birth certificate for anyone who was born in Marlborough, or if the parents listed Marlborough as their residence at the time of the birth. You have two ways in which you can obtain a Birth Certificate.

You can come in person to the City Clerk's Office, or you can send a request by mail. If you wish to request a copy by mail, please click on this LINK and follow the instructions.

Please bear in mind that it can take up to four weeks for our office to receive a residential copy of a birth, if your child was born in another community. Also, if the parents were not married when the child was born, the birth certificate becomes restricted. Restricted means that only those listed on the birth record can obtain a copy of the restricted birth certificate and you must show a valid ID (driver's License, State ID, or Passport).

How to obtain a Marriage Certificate

If you filed for a marriage license in the City of Marlborough, you can get a certified copy of your marriage certificate here.  You have two ways in which you can obtain a Marriage Certificate.

You can come in person to the City Clerk's Office, or you can send a request by mail. If you wish to request a copy by mail, please click on this LINK and follow the instructions.

Please note that some marriage records are restricted.  Restricted means that the parents of either person were not married when they were born.  Only the persons listed on the marriage certificate may obtain a copy and you must show a valid ID (driver’s License, State ID or Passport).


How to obtain a Death Certificate

You can get a death certificate for anyone who died in the City of Marlborough or listed Marlborough as their residence at the time of their death.

You can come in person to the City Clerk's Office, or you can send a request by mail. If you wish to request a copy by mail, please click on this LINK and follow the instructions.


Keep in mind

Massachusetts General Law only allows certain people to get a copy of a restricted birth certificate. If a record is RESTRICTED, only those people listed on the record can get a certified copy.

Legal guardians can get a copy of a child’s birth certificate by showing their court order and a valid ID.

If you legally change your name, that does not change your name on your birth certificate. If you were adopted, your birth certificate after your adoption is the only copy we can give you.
